Output e66a5f4c3086d2c1923c9bbaf16292ab4a298d381c87bf2aaf371c15c2f8b1c2:1

value
16670000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e88a910c566523d85ce12c7bc144019909c18404 OP_EQUALVERIFY OP_CHECKSIG
address
1NCZmHGNDqdpiG2A63Jyx2qqSqBvtgR9x6
transaction
e66a5f4c3086d2c1923c9bbaf16292ab4a298d381c87bf2aaf371c15c2f8b1c2
spent
true